CROWD SAW SUICIDE

SYDNEY, Sunday.—Before a crowd of about 1,000 people Edward Kendall, of Cook's crescent, East Hills, shot himself

through the heart with a pea-rifle at the East Hills railway station to-day. The

crowd had gathered to celebrate the opening of an electric train service from Kingsgrove.
